This Mega Man Costume Was Made for $50

The notion of cosplay being an expensive hobby can turn off people who are interested in pursuing it, but you don’t have to fork out a lot of money to craft costumes. You can dive in with what you have. Stoosh Costuming & Cosplay focuses on keeping his creations as inexpensive as possible by using economical materials and everyday household objects. Case in point: this Mega Man costume.

Stoosh recently completed the set of armor for Calgary Comic and Entertainment Expo and did so for about $50. He used EVA foam, unsurprisingly, but also a few other items. He says:

EVA foam, protein containers, laundry bin lids and an old bike helmet liner. LOL. All the costumes I make are super cheap, made from stuff I have lying around the house.
